A digital goodbye: Aura Funerals raises €905K to modernise end-of-life planning

Aura Funerals, a London-based digital end-of-life planning and funeral service, has announced a successful €905k funding round through Angel Investment Network in order to develop digital pre-planning technology and eco-friendly funerals.

This marks Aura’s third successful raise through the network. The funds were raised as part of a larger €3.8 million growth funding round.

According to Benedict May, Chief Operating Officer from Aura Funerals: “AIN’s continued support speaks volumes about their confidence in our vision to modernise funeral care with compassion and technology. We’ve been at the forefront of innovation in the sector, enabling individuals to personalise final farewells online or by phone, saving thousands and easing the emotional and administrative burden. This funding will be instrumental in expanding our services and strengthening our commitment to innovative, sustainable end-of-life solutions.”

Aura Funerals, founded in 2019 by David Jameson and Benedict May, is innovating the funeral care process by digitising and simplifying arrangements, making them more affordable and flexible for their users.

The company “prioritises compassionate support” and offers comprehensive planning resources to assist families during challenging times, including features such as funeral plan comparisons.

According to Aura, following recent market changes, it is one of fewer than 30 FCA-regulated funeral providers.

Staff at the company are referred to as ‘Aura Angels’, offering personalised services to their customers. According to Aura, the Aura Angels “listen, help and guide you along the journey. With an Aura Angel, it’s personal. They’ll get to know you and your family, helping you arrange a funeral that truly reflects the person you love. Your Angel will be there to support you every step of the way. They’ll arrange the cremation, handle any paperwork or simply sit and listen.”

Also included is the ‘Aura Circle’, a free membership that gives you access to their planning and legacy tools, workshops and exclusive content. Features offered included registering the user’s funeral wishes, creating a digital life story with their family members, and even leaving a message to be delivered in the future.

According to the company, there are currently 30k members in the Aura Circle, where they share stories and engage in community discussions.

Matthew Louis, senior broker from Angel Investment Network, added: “Aura provides a heartfelt and dignified farewell, ensuring every goodbye is filled with compassion, respect, and simplicity. Angel Investors have truly embraced their vision of disrupting an archaic and confusing market and modernising it with a compassionate approach to supporting those in need. Aura has some great partners for the next stage of its journey.”

This latest investment will fuel several key initiatives including digital pre-planning technology, eco-friendly funerals and imbedding AI into their operations. The business will also continue growing their end-of-life hub and owned media to drive down acquisition costs and drive brand awareness into the wider market.
